SCRIPTURE: Genesis (NIV) 35:1 Then God said to Jacob, “Go up to Bethel and settle there, and build an altar there to God, who appeared to you when you were fleeing from your brother Esau.” 2 So Jacob said to his household and to all who were with him, “Get rid of the foreign gods you have with you, and purify yourselves and change your clothes. 3 Then come, let us go up to Bethel, where I will build an altar to God, who answered me in the day of my distress and who has been with me wherever I have gone.” 4 So they gave Jacob all the foreign gods they had and the rings in their ears, and Jacob buried them under the oak at Shechem. 5 Then they set out, and the terror of God fell upon the towns all around them so that no-one pursued them.
OBSERVATION: Jacob set himself to obey God, to go to Bethel, establish his household there and build an altar to God. Since they were committing themselves to Jehovah God, they needed to get rid of any foreign gods and take off clothing that may have been designed around those gods.
And as they moved out in obedience, the Lord set the greatest security system any people ever had. Fear! Not because they were such a great company, they were really few in number. Not a fear because they were mighty warriors. No, it was the “terror of God!” Jacob was doing his part (obedience); God was doing HIS part!
